This is our go-to place for Chinese food.We love ordering for weekend dinners. Great food with great prices.The owner Jenny is fantastic. Jenny (or her sister) will modify any dish.Now my sister (Bellerose) and my parents (Florida) order from Jian-on too.
April 20 · Karen PonzoGreat take out Chinese Food.Graded an “A” and I can See why!clean place and great taste.Eat in “Decor” could be nicer for this neighborhood.Only cash, so keep that in mind.
July 23 · johnny bravoleNever been here before. I was hungry and craving Chinese food. Just your typical Chinese takeout place. Ordered bean curd szechuan style. Was delicious and generous portion. Will definitely come back.
September 30 · Aryeh P.These guys are great. Friendly little shop with grey food. They gave me some candy too :)
May 15 · Uchenna IkwuakorThe worst food you could have..! Their fried rice is like so awful.I ordered pork schezwan..! It was just the sauce on the pork and undercooked.Their egg roll was like awful one could taste the oil in it, they might keep reusing the oil for a longer days and the oil taste was really filthy.Would never again order from here.Their veggies were so big it wouldn’t even fit in a fork to eat. 😞As the COVID-19 surges they still cook the food and interact with people with No Mask 😷NO GLOVES 🧤 really disappointed
